39 * The Realtek 10/100 PHYs are mostly standard compliant, but they
40 * lack a true vendor/device ID for the integrated PHY, and they don't
41 * report the "detected" non-Nway link speed in the appropriate
42 * registers.
44 static int rtl8139_check(phy_handle_t *);
45 static int rtl8201_check(phy_handle_t *);
47 boolean_t
48 phy_realtek_probe(phy_handle_t *ph)
50 if ((ph->phy_id == 0) &&
51 (strcmp(phy_get_driver(ph), "rtls") == 0)) {
52 ph->phy_vendor = "Realtek";
53 ph->phy_model = "Internal RTL8139";
54 ph->phy_check = rtl8139_check;
55 return (B_TRUE);
56 } else if (ph->phy_id == 0x8201) {
57 ph->phy_vendor = "Realtek";
58 ph->phy_model = "RTL8201";
59 ph->phy_check = rtl8201_check;
60 return (B_TRUE);
61 } else {
62 return (B_FALSE);
66 static int
67 rtl8139_check(phy_handle_t *ph)
69 int rv;
70 uint16_t s;
72 rv = phy_check(ph);
75 * We possibly override settings, so that we can use the PHYs
76 * autodetected link speed if the partner isn't doing NWay.
78 s = phy_read(ph, MII_VENDOR(0));
79 if (s & (1 << 2)) {
80 ph->phy_link = LINK_STATE_DOWN;
81 } else {
82 ph->phy_link = LINK_STATE_UP;
83 if (s & (1 << 3)) {
84 ph->phy_speed = 10;
85 } else {
86 ph->phy_speed = 100;
90 return (rv);
